@charset "UTF-8";
/*if using web font by google*/
/*@import url("https://fonts.googleapis.com/css2?family=Zen+Kaku+Gothic+New:wght@400;700&display=swap");*/


/*bootstrap > overwrite bootstrap
mtx framework > overwrite mtx-framework */

/*mtx-framework*/
@import "_framework/bg.scss";
@import "_framework/button.scss";
@import "_framework/effect.scss";
@import "_framework/font_option.scss";
@import "_framework/font_size.scss";
@import "_framework/margin_padding.scss";

/*compornent*/
@import "_parts/scroll_effect.scss";
@import "_parts/photo_gallery.scss";
@import "_parts/top_carousel.scss";
@import "_parts/accordion.scss";

@import "_parts/border.scss";
@import "_parts/box.scss";

/*@import "_parts/button_custom.scss";*/
@import "_parts/icon_for_button.scss";


/*parts of navigation*/
/*navi for large screen*/
/*@import "_navi/navi_grayscale3.scss";*/

@import "_navi/navi_main.scss";
/*@import "_navi/navi_css_pulldown.scss";*/

/*navi for smart-phone*/
@import "_navi/navi_drawer.scss";

/*navi side & bottom*/
@import "_navi/navi_scroll.scss";


/*color-setting for this web site*/
@import "_site/color.scss";

/*css for each page of this web site*/
@import "_site/section.scss";

/*typography-setting for this web site*/
@import "_typography/font_family_shippori.scss";
@import "_typography/font_family_zen_kaku_gothic_new.scss";
@import "_typography/font_tag_size.scss";
